Tue, Mar. 14th, 2006, 02:27 pm
[info]faxpaladin: All-Con, AggieCon and housefilk

All-Con 2 is being held this weekend at the Sterling Hotel in Dallas. The Brobdingnagian Bards will perform at 6 p.m. in the House of Commons (the function rooms have a British theme), then host an open filk in the same room starting at 11 p.m. On Sunday in the Edinburgh House room they'll have a panel at 11 a.m., then a 2-hour "Write Filk With the Bards" workshop at 1 p.m.

AggieCon 37, the next weekend on the A&M campus in College Station, will have Friday and Saturday night open filking (when and where precisely isn't set yet; apparently they're not going to release the schedule online). There will be a Filk 101 panel, and possibly a Firefly filk panel (if there isn't the latter we'll just designate the first hour of the Saturday night filk as having a Firefly/Serenity theme). There will also be a concert by author Guest of Honor Steven Brust (his show last year at ConDFW was pretty cool stuff).
